Arthur Longbottom Born: Leeds, Yorkshire: 30-01-1933 Arthur Longbottom signed for the club. March 03,1954 from Methley Utd, West Riding. He made his debut in the No.8 shirt against Leyton Orient (away) March 12, 1955. Orient winning 3-0. In all competitions. Apps:214. Goals:67. March 1961 he was transferred to Port Vale for £2,000 Following the end of his football career he changed his surname by deed poll to Langley. The reason for changing his name was to save his children from ridicule. Arthur at the age of 80 resides in Scarborough. Original press photo.1958-59 season. Original press photo.
